Sayat Abdrakhmanov, manager of UFC fighter disqualified for 9 months Arman Tsarukyan told that his client will be able to return to performances in October.
Following a meeting of the Nevada State Athletic Commission, Tsarukyan received a nine-month disqualification for a fight with a fan during a fight. The incident occurred on April 13 at UFC 300 before the fight with Charles Oliveira. The victory in the fight made Tsarukyan a contender for the lightweight champion belt, which belongs to Islam Makhachev. One possible date for the fight was October 26, when the UFC holds a traditional tournament in Abu Dhabi.
“The disqualification can be reduced to 6 months, Arman will use this option to be available in October,” Abdrakhmanov told .
If the disqualification period is reduced to six months, Tsarukyan will be able to fight from October 13.
